Company Profile:

Johnson Controls International PLC is a multinational conglomerate based in Cork, Ireland, with operations in over 150 countries. The company was founded in 1885 by Warren S. Johnson as the Johnson Electric Service Company, specializing in temperature regulation systems. Over the years, it expanded its portfolio to include building automation, HVAC systems, security, and fire safety solutions. In 2016, Johnson Controls merged with Tyco International, forming Johnson Controls International PLC.

The core business areas of Johnson Controls International PLC include building technologies, which encompass security, fire safety, HVAC, and building automation systems. The company serves a wide range of sectors, including commercial buildings, industrial facilities, healthcare, and residential properties.

The leadership team of Johnson Controls International PLC is led by George Oliver, who serves as the Chairman and CEO. The corporate structure includes various business units focused on different product lines and regions, ensuring a strategic approach to global operations.

Recent Acquisitions (last 3 years):

  1. Qolsys Inc. (2020): Johnson Controls International PLC acquired Qolsys Inc., a leading provider of security and smart home automation solutions. This acquisition was made to enhance the company's portfolio of connected technologies and strengthen its position in the residential security market.

  2. Lux Products Corporation (2019): Johnson Controls International PLC acquired Lux Products Corporation, a manufacturer of smart thermostats and home comfort solutions. This acquisition was aimed at expanding the company's presence in the residential HVAC market and offering customers more energy-efficient options.

Johnson Controls International plc, together with its subsidiaries, engages in engineering, manufacturing, commissioning, and retrofitting building products and systems in the United States, Europe, the Asia Pacific, and internationally. It operates in four segments: Building Solutions North America, Building Solutions EMEA/LA, Building Solutions Asia Pacific, and Global Products. The company designs, sells, installs, and services heating, ventilating, air conditioning, controls, building management, refrigeration, integrated electronic security, integrated fire detection and suppression systems, and fire protection and security products for commercial, industrial, retail, small business, institutional, and governmental customers. It also provides energy efficiency solutions and technical services, including inspection, scheduled maintenance, and repair and replacement of mechanical and control systems, as well as data-driven smart building solutions to non-residential building and industrial applications. In addition, the company offers control software and software services for residential and commercial applications. Johnson Controls International plc was incorporated in 1885 and is headquartered in Cork, Ireland.
